History of South Dakota

Rate this book

Herbert S. Schell provides a picture of South Dakota's political, economic, social, and environmental history, identifying the local, regional, national, and global forces that shaped the fortieth state through World War II. John E. Miller picks up the story at the beginning of the Cold War and chronicles the rest of the twentieth century.

So, here's the thing. South Dakota has a really interesting history. The Battle of Little Big Horn, the Black Hills gold rush, the Titan missiles, etc...but this author seems to only care about the ballot counts for state and local politicians and what farm bills they proposed. It is like he wants people to dislike his book.

The section on the state's 20th and 21st century history was rather lacking. Lots of stuff missing in here (how can you only have a brief one or two-sentence mention of the carving of Mt. Rushmore?) The modern era of South Dakota history seemed to fly by as if few important things have happened in the state in the last 70 years. Schell did his part, but Miller came up short.
